Big Star: The Nick Skelton Story
Crashing into the British showjumping scene during the heyday of the sport in the 1970s, Nick Skelton dominates the competition until he breaks his neck in an unlucky fall. Doctors tell him to quit riding, but he refuses to give up. He makes an against-all-odds comeback and pursues his elusive dream of winning an Olympic gold medal with the help of his once-in-a-lifetime horse Big Star.
Golden Genes: The secret of Dutch jumpers
In 2016, Nick Skelton won first place at the Summer Olympic Games in Rio. The Englishman did so on the back of a horse bred in the Netherlands. This documentary is in search of the secret of the Dutch horse breeder and discovers that success also has a flip side. The sperm of a winning horse is invaluable and therefore it leads to painful decisions in the world of sports.
